Estadísticas interesantes de Cuba Josef Beck / Alamy Stock Photo Josh Edelson / ZUMA Press, Inc. / Alamy Stock Photo Bandera de Cuba Pesos cubanos Capital: La Habana tipo de gobierno: república socialista tamaño: un poco más pequeño que el estado de Pensilvania población: 11 147 470 lengua: español Moneda: peso cubano Nivel de alfabetización: 99,8 % promedio de vida: 78 años Expresiones y palabras típicas ¿Qué bolá, asere? ¿Qué tal, amigo? ¡Bárbaro! ¡Chévere!
